The low profile makes it super versatile for pants or shorts. That patent leather mudguard catches the light in a really subtle, premium way. It’s one of those shoes that looks even better on foot than in the box. Definitely a head-turner for any sneaker enthusiast. In summary: A fantastic lifestyle shoe. Iconic design, great materials, versatile fit. Price is steep for the tech you get, but you're paying for the legacy / that unbeatable look. If you dig the style, you won't be disappointed. It fills a specific niche. You get the iconic look, great materials, and a comfortable fit in a more manageable package. The Air Jordan 11 Retro Low isn't trying to be the high-top – it's its own thing, and it does it really well. On foot, the Air Jordan 11 Retro Low just "works". The low-cut design makes them incredibly versatile for summer fits with shorts. The Concord colorway pops against any outfit, and the patent leather shines "just" right in sunlight - not too flashy. I've worn them out a few times, and they grab looks. The silhouette is timeless. Compared to a bulkier Jordan 4 or 5, these feel sleek and streamlined. A definite style win.
